1. Programming for Efficiency
One of the most significant advantages of a smart thermostat is its ability to learn and adapt to your schedule. I’ve found that setting up a consistent programming schedule not only saves energy but also ensures that my home is always at the perfect temperature when I need it. For example, I’ve programmed mine to lower the temperature slightly during the night and raise it just before I wake up. This has resulted in noticeable energy savings without sacrificing comfort.
2. Integrating with Other Smart Devices
Another fantastic feature is the ability to integrate your thermostat with other smart devices. For instance, I’ve set up my thermostat to automatically adjust when my security system is armed or disarmed. This integration has made my home feel more secure and energy-efficient. 3. Energy Reports and Insights
Most smart thermostats come with energy reports that provide insights into your heating and cooling usage. I’ve found these reports incredibly helpful in understanding how my home consumes energy and identifying areas where I can make improvements. For example, I discovered that my home was using more energy during the early morning hours, so I adjusted the schedule to reduce heating during that time.
4. Common Issues and Solutions
-
Problem: Thermostat Not Responding to Voice Commands
- Solution: Ensure that your thermostat is connected to the same Wi-Fi network as your voice assistant device. Sometimes, a simple restart of both devices can resolve connectivity issues.
-
Problem: Inconsistent Temperature Settings
- Solution: Check if your thermostat is placed in an optimal location. Avoid placing it near drafty windows, heating vents, or other sources of direct heat or cold.
